你查询的IP:[116.4.140.181]  地理位置:中国–广东–东莞

最新查询121.89.3.188 117.76.11.58 116.244.231.185 202.127.6.74 121.16.82.42 221.12.83.22 58.82.70.246 121.76.50.142 119.38.73.239 116.4.140.181 58.32.89.12 203.191.64.100 202.60.112.126 202.38.136.41 118.224.127.50 119.27.64.8 218.240.219.235 118.91.240.7 202.90.210.112 202.165.96.174 221.208.220.177 203.161.192.204 121.204.132.122 125.171.29.184 202.96.91.23 202.189.80.99 124.42.64.73 203.95.25.192 202.91.63.232 219.128.223.65 123.49.128.238